Comprehending Key and Lock Failures in Scenic Areas

Characteristic located in beautiful destinations-- whether nestled in range of mountains, set down along coastal cliffs, or tucked away in rural countryside-- face specific environmental elements that speed up wear and tear on locks and keys.

Ecological Factors

  • Salt Air and Humidity: Coastal homes experience high levels of moisture and salt in the air, which leads to rust and deterioration inside lock cylinders.
  • Extreme Temperatures: Mountain areas experience freezing winter seasons and hot summers, triggering metals to expand and contract consistently, which damages the structural integrity of secrets.
  • Dirt and Debris: Rural and wooded areas often expose locks to windblown dust, pine needles, and grit that can jam the mechanism.

When a key undergoes a stiff or corroded lock, users typically use additional force. This excess torque is the main reason secrets snap off inside the keyway.

What to Do When a Key Breaks: A Step-by-Step Guide

If a key breaks off inside a lock, panic is the natural first reaction. However, handling the scenario properly avoids further damage to the locking system.

  • Step 1: Assess the SituationDetermine how much of the key is extending from the lock. If a significant portion shows up, it may be possible to carefully pull it out with needle-nose pliers.
  • Step 2: Avoid Using AdhesivesNever ever try to glue the broken piece back into the lock using superglue. The glue will undoubtedly seep into the delicate internal tumblers, rendering the whole lock totally ineffective and needing a pricey replacement.
  • Step 3: Refrain from Forceful ProbingPrevent sticking screwdrivers, paperclips, or hairpin wires into the keyway. This typically pushes the broken piece deeper into the cylinder or jams the internal pins.
  • Step 4: Lubricate (If Applicable)If the lock is stiff, a graphite-based lube can help relieve the extraction procedure. Prevent oil-based lubricants like WD-40 for outdoor locks in dusty environments, as they bring in gunk.
  • Step 5: Call a Professional Scenic LocksmithContact a mobile locksmith who services the city. They bring specialized broken-key extractor packages that get rid of the fragment safely without damaging the housing.

Preventive Maintenance Tips to Avoid Key Emergencies

An ounce of prevention deserves a pound of treatment. Implementing a couple of easy upkeep practices can substantially extend the lifespan of locks and secrets.

  • Tidy and Lubricate Annually: Spray a dry graphite lubricant into lock cylinders at least when a year, particularly before winter sets in.
